Part 2 of the DIA-CIRS Workshop
Unmet medical need definition has been attempted to detangle by different groups. Different elements of a possible criteria is presented as a background for the discussion on Day 3.
Learning Objective : Describe criteria currently used and identify a core list of criteria that should be used to identify and prioritize unmet medical need; Discuss what constitutes an unmet medical need and determine universal agreement on key characteristics
